EdB Interface UI Mod Spotlight Rimworld Mods
EdB Interface UI Mod is a user interface mod for RimWorld that makes a few adjustments to the default game interface. Originally, there were one or two things in the UI that I felt like I wanted to change to increase my efficiency, and this mod started as a proof-of-concept to see if I could tweak them. It expanded from there, and the 2.x versions now include a couple of bigger features.

More About the Mod
The mod makes the following adjustments to the user interface:
Adds the Colonist Status Bar along the top of the gameplay window, giving you another way to select colonists and to quickly see their current status.
Adds an Inventory dialog, showing counts of all of your colony's resources, apparel, weapons, buildings, etc.
Adds a "Colonist" button next to Architect button. Clicking the button selects a colonist. Continue clicking to select each colonist in turn. Left-clicking selects the next colonist. Right-clicking selects the previous colonist. Selecting a colonist in this way does not center your view on that colonist.
When an object is selected, buttons are available for commands that normally only appear in the "Orders" menu. For example, when a Muffalo is selected, a "Hunt" button appears; when a rock chunk is selected, a "Haul" button appears; etc.
Changes some of the game's panels and dialogs, including the Colonist panels, the Bills panel, the Growing panel and the Overview Work dialog. The panels are a consistent size and attempt to reduce the number of clicks it takes to accomplish certain tasks, where possible.
If you don't like a particular feature in the mod, turn it off in the Interface Options dialog which you can get to from the gameplay menu. Since a couple of features are not enabled by default, be sure to take a look at the options to see everything that's available.

Some features are better suited for larger window sizes, but if you're running in a smaller window, you can shut off the features that do not work as well.
